PRESS RELEASE
Issued by: Del Mar Avionics
Del Mar Avionics will be exhibiting two Model O Hydra Set ® precision load positioners at the AeroDef 2011 Exposition. These units are capable of positioning valuable loads to 1,000 pounds (452.5 kg) to within 0.001" (0.025mm) thus eliminating damage when mating or de-mating valuable loads. The NASA certified wireless model provides a safe, remote means for mating of heavy loads in applications where a crane or hoist is employed and starts and stops might otherwise result in oscillations with resulting in damage to critical components.
Hydra Set load positioners, are available in 13 models to safely and reliably position critical loads of up to 300 ton (272,000 kg) to within 0.001 inch (.025mm). These precision load positioners ensure protection from damage to sensitive, expensive components, instantly indicating any resistance to the load's linear travel caused by binding or chafing of the load against unsuspected obstacles or obstructions.
Wireless models can be operated from a distance of up to 1,000' (305 meters) from the positioner, and an available remote control console with a positive fluid retention system protects spacecraft and other clean-room components from contamination.
Since 1965, Del Mar Avionics has supplied more than 3,000 Hydra Set Precision Load Positioners worldwide for aerospace; commercial aviation; military; nuclear and fossil fuel power generation; shipbuilding; railway and other heavy industry applications.
